Digital Cardiac Auscultation

Cardiac auscultation is essential in medical practice and an indispensable complement to the clinical examination. Learning the cardiac auscultation technique is of utmost importance once the identified alterations often constitute the first indicators of cardiac disease and allow delineating the initial strategies of complementary study and therapeutic orientation. Acoustic stethoscopes have been the instruments traditionally used in auscultation teaching.
